1. A method of installing a medical screw comprising the steps of:

  • providing a medical screw having a head for receiving a screw driving device and a shaft extending from said head along a longitudinal axis, wherein said shaft includes (a) a threaded portion including helical threads and (b) a distal guiding tip extending longitudinally and distally from the threaded portion and including a cylindrical portion;

    drilling an implantation site into bone at a desired location, the implantation site having a cylindrical core;

    tapping the cylindrical core with tracks that correspond to the helical threads; and

    inserting said distal guiding tip into said implantation site at a depth sufficient that a surface of the cylindrical portion contacts at least three points on the cylindrical core with each of the at least three points being separated by a track.
